Quote:
ToobyNT said: I think with lower temps, they have slower growth??
Not true at all, they are more contam resistant and will usually be stalled. To properly fruit a pf cake you really need to raise the temp, humidity after a proper dunk and roll, 76 is perfect cakes are picky, this raises the temp to 80 degrees inside the cake.
Fruiting is induced by humidity, Fresh air exchange and light. Mist and fan 3 times a day, do not soak just a proper mist, make sure light is 6500k and make sure your SGFC is properly built
I have had to buy a space heater and it takes care of the problem right away.
